The article highlights the clinical and epidemiological significance of sudden cardiac death (SCD) in athletes, its main causes, and methods of risk assessment. Although rare, SCD has considerable social and medical importance. Risk evaluation includes clinical examination, ECG, echocardiography, exercise testing, and genetic analysis when needed. Preventive measures emphasize initial screening and regular monitoring of at-risk groups.
